Science 4 Lesson 1 

Today I learned that spiders are not insects.  Insects have six legs, and have antennas.  Spiders have eight legs and no antennas.  I also learned that insects have three body segments: the head, thorax, and abdomen.  Butterflies taste with their feet, but most bugs taste with their mouth.  Also insects have two compound eyes, and in between the two compound eyes are what is called the simple eyes known as the ocelli.  I also learned that most bugs are eaten, and people can survive on bugs.
